Civil wedding procedure in Jedlińsk
A civil wedding in Jedlińsk begins with filing a declaration of no impediment to marriage at the Civil Registry Office. The engaged couple should arrange a visit in advance to set the ceremony date.
From the moment of filing the declaration, a statutory waiting period of at least one month applies. During this period, the Civil Registry Office in Jedlińsk conducts verification proceedings. After this time has elapsed, it is possible to enter into marriage.
Polish citizens should bring a valid identity card or passport. Certified copies of birth certificates are obtained by the Civil Registry Office from the civil registry, so usually they do not need to be provided independently.
Foreigners must prepare:
- identity document,
- certified copy of birth certificate,
- certificate of legal capacity to enter into marriage issued by the competent authorities of the country of origin,
- sworn translations of foreign language documents.
Each of the engaged couple must designate 2 adult witnesses. Witnesses can be persons of any nationality.
The tax fee for drawing up the marriage certificate is 84 złoty. The certificate is issued directly after the ceremony, and the first certified short copy is free of charge.
The possibility of having a wedding outside the seat of the Civil Registry Office in Jedlińsk is associated with an additional fee of 1000 złoty. This requires ensuring safe and dignified conditions for conducting the ceremony.
